The Indus University syllabus is designed to give students a complete mix of academic knowledge, practical skills, and professional exposure across all programs. It follows a Choice-Based Credit System (CBCS), where every subject, lab, project, and internship carries a fixed number of credits.
For undergraduate programs (UG) such as B.Tech, BBA, BCA, and B.Pharm, students must complete around 120–130 credits over six to eight semesters, depending on the course. Each semester carries about 20–22 credits, which include core subjects, elective papers, skill enhancement courses, and practical training. For postgraduate programs (PG) like MBA, M.Tech, and MCA, students need to complete 80–100 credits across four semesters.
Indus University Syllabus for Engineering Programs 2026
The Bachelor of Technology (B.Tech) program at Indus University, Ahmedabad, is a four-year undergraduate course divided into eight semesters. It focuses on building strong technical knowledge, problem-solving skills, and practical experience in engineering. The syllabus is designed according to AICTE guidelines and regularly updated to meet industry needs. It follows a credit-based system, where each subject, lab, and project carries a certain number of credits. To graduate, students must complete approximately 160–170 credits over four years.
The program includes core engineering subjects, elective courses, laboratory sessions, internships, and a final-year major project, ensuring a balance between theory and hands-on learning. Students also study communication skills, ethics, and management, preparing them for leadership roles in the professional world.
Indus University B.Tech CSE Syllabus
| Semester | Subjects / Courses | Credits |
|---|---|---|
| Semester 1 | Engineering Mathematics I, Engineering Physics, Engineering Chemistry, Basic Electrical Engineering, Engineering Graphics, Communication Skills, Workshop Practice | 20 |
| Semester 2 | Engineering Mathematics II, Programming for Problem Solving (C Language), Basic Electronics, Environmental Studies, Engineering Mechanics, Computer-Aided Design Lab | 21 |
| Semester 3 | Data Structures, Digital Logic Design, Object-Oriented Programming (C++/Java), Electrical Circuits and Systems, Discrete Mathematics, Lab on OOP and Data Structures | 20 |
| Semester 4 | Database Management Systems, Signals and Systems, Engineering Mathematics III, Microprocessors and Interfaces, Computer Networks, DBMS Lab, Microprocessor Lab | 21 |
| Semester 5 | Operating Systems, Design and Analysis of Algorithms, Control Systems, Software Engineering, Elective I (AI/IoT/Robotics), Summer Internship / Mini Project | 20 |
| Semester 6 | Machine Learning, Embedded Systems, Industrial Management, Web Technology, Elective II (Cloud Computing / Cyber Security), Lab Work and Industrial Training | 21 |
| Semester 7 | Internet of Things (IoT), Big Data Analytics, Professional Ethics & Values, Elective III (Blockchain / AR-VR / Data Science), Project Phase I | 22 |
| Semester 8 | Entrepreneurship & Innovation, Project Phase II (Major Project), Seminar & Viva-Voce, Internship Evaluation | 25 |
Indus University Syllabus for Management Programs 2026
The Bachelor of Business Administration (BBA) program at Indus University is a three-year undergraduate degree divided into six semesters. It aims to build a strong foundation in business management, leadership, communication, and entrepreneurship. The syllabus is designed to help students understand how businesses operate and how effective decision-making, teamwork, and innovation drive success. Each semester includes a mix of core subjects, electives, skill-based courses, and practical projects. The program follows a credit-based system, with students required to complete around 120–130 credits to earn the degree.
Indus University BBA Syllabus
| Semester | Subjects / Courses | Credits |
|---|---|---|
| Semester 1 | Principles of Management, Business Communication, Microeconomics, Financial Accounting, Computer Fundamentals, Environmental Studies | 21 |
| Semester 2 | Organisational Behaviour, Marketing Management, Business Mathematics, Cost Accounting, Business Law, Entrepreneurship Development | 22 |
| Semester 3 | Human Resource Management, Business Statistics, Financial Management, Research Methodology, E-Commerce, Soft Skills & Personality Development | 21 |
| Semester 4 | Operations Management, Business Ethics and Corporate Governance, Management Information Systems, Consumer Behaviour, Quantitative Techniques, Minor Project | 22 |
| Semester 5 | International Business, Strategic Management, Industrial Relations, Sales and Distribution Management, Summer Internship Project | 22 |
| Semester 6 | Service Marketing, Investment and Portfolio Management, Total Quality Management, Business Policy and Strategic Analysis, Major Project / Dissertation | 22 |
